Scammers pose as staffing firms, target job seekers

NEW YORK, UNITED STATES — Job seekers are now threatened by scammers masquerading as reputable staffing firms like Recruit Holdings, Persol Holdings, and Beacon Hill Staffing Group.
These fraudsters lure candidates with false job offers, aiming to rob personal details.
Beacon Hill advises applicants to be wary of certain signs such as being rushed into decisions, demands for money, personal details, financial information, outreach via unrelated emails or unexpected texts, and deals that appear overly attractive.
Job applicants should immediately consult their recruiter if they encounter dubious messages. Direct communication with the company’s official website is also recommended.
Scammers have become more audacious with the rise of remote work, leading to a staggering US$367 million loss in 2022 due to job and business scams, marking a 76% increase from the year prior.
The New York Department of State’s Division of Consumer, referencing Federal Trade Commission data, also noted a fourfold spike in reported job and business scam cases from 2018 to 2022.
